硬件工程师在系统资源分配中的职责?

在当今这个科技飞速发展的时代,硬件工程师在系统资源分配中的职责显得尤为重要。他们不仅要具备扎实的硬件知识,还要具备良好的系统资源管理能力。本文将深入探讨硬件工程师在系统资源分配中的职责,帮助读者更好地了解这一关键角色。

一、硬件工程师在系统资源分配中的重要性

  1. 系统性能优化:硬件工程师负责对系统资源进行合理分配,以确保系统在运行过程中性能稳定,满足用户需求。

  2. 降低成本:通过合理分配资源,硬件工程师可以帮助企业降低硬件成本,提高资源利用率。

  3. 提高系统可靠性:在系统资源分配过程中,硬件工程师需要充分考虑系统稳定性,确保系统在复杂环境下正常运行。

二、硬件工程师在系统资源分配中的具体职责

  1. 需求分析:首先,硬件工程师需要了解系统的应用场景、性能要求等,为资源分配提供依据。

  2. 硬件选型:根据需求分析结果,硬件工程师选择合适的硬件设备,如CPU、内存、硬盘等。

  3. 资源分配策略制定:针对不同硬件设备,硬件工程师需要制定相应的资源分配策略,如内存管理、CPU调度等。

  4. 系统优化:在系统运行过程中,硬件工程师需要不断优化系统资源分配策略,以提高系统性能。

  5. 故障排查:当系统出现问题时,硬件工程师需要迅速定位故障原因,并采取相应措施解决。

三、案例分析

以下是一个关于硬件工程师在系统资源分配中的案例分析:

案例背景:某企业开发了一款高性能服务器,用于处理大量数据。然而,在实际运行过程中,服务器性能不稳定,导致数据处理速度缓慢。

案例分析

  1. 需求分析:硬件工程师首先对服务器应用场景和性能要求进行分析,发现内存资源分配不合理,导致CPU频繁访问内存,影响性能。

  2. 硬件选型:针对内存资源分配问题,硬件工程师选择了一款高速内存,并调整了内存分配策略。

  3. 系统优化:通过优化内存分配策略,服务器性能得到了显著提升,数据处理速度达到了预期。

四、总结

硬件工程师在系统资源分配中的职责至关重要。他们需要具备扎实的硬件知识、良好的系统资源管理能力,以及敏锐的故障排查能力。只有通过不断优化系统资源分配策略,才能确保系统在复杂环境下稳定运行,满足用户需求。

关键词:硬件工程师、系统资源分配、性能优化、成本降低、可靠性、需求分析、硬件选型、资源分配策略、系统优化、故障排查

猜你喜欢:人力资源产业互联平台